Cargar Datos

Cree un bloque de almacenamiento en su arrendamiento de Oracle Cloud Infrastructure.

Preparar Almacenamiento de Objetos para Integración

Debe crear un contenedor o bloque para almacenar objetos de datos en Oracle Cloud Infrastructure Object Storage.

  1. Acceda a la consola de Oracle Cloud Infrastructure Object Storage.
  2. Haga clic en Almacenamiento y, a continuación, en Almacenamiento de objetos.
  3. Haga clic en Crear Cubo.
  4. Asigne al bloque un nombre que identifique los datos, como salesdb-bucket.
  5. Haga clic en Estándar como nivel de almacenamiento.
  6. Si desea que Oracle Cloud Infrastructure gestione las claves de cifrado, haga clic en Cifrar con Claves Gestionadas por Oracle para Cifrado. Si desea aprovechar sus propias claves, haga clic en Encrypt Using Customer-Managed Keys (Cifrar mediante claves gestionadas por elcliente)..
  7. Haga clic en Crear Cubo.

Cargar Archivos de Datos en Almacenamiento

Cargue archivos de datos del sistema local en el bloque de almacenamiento de objetos que ha creado anteriormente.

Puede utilizar la consola para cargar archivos de 2 GB o más pequeños.

  1. En la pantalla Detalles de almacenamiento de objetos, haga clic en el nombre del bloque para ver sus detalles.
  2. Haga clic en Cargar objetos.
  3. Seleccione el objeto u objetos para cargar de una de las dos formas siguientes:
    • Arrastre archivos desde la computadora a la sección Soltar archivos aquí....
    • Haga clic en el enlace para seleccionar los archivos para mostrar un cuadro de diálogo de selección de archivos.

    Al seleccionar los archivos que desea cargar, se muestran en una lista de desplazamiento. Si decide que no desea cargar un archivo que ha seleccionado, haga clic en el icono X a la derecha del nombre del archivo.

    Si los archivos seleccionados para cargar y los archivos ya almacenados en el bloque tienen el mismo nombre, se muestran mensajes que advierten de la sobrescritura.

  4. En el campo Prefijo de Nombre de Objeto, especifique opcionalmente un prefijo de nombre de archivo para el archivo que ha seleccionado para cargar.
  5. Haga clic en Cargar objetos.

    Los objetos seleccionados se cargan y muestran en la lista de objetos del bloque.

Cargar archivos grandes en almacenamiento de datos

Cargue archivos de datos de más de 2 GB del sistema local en un bloque de almacenamiento de objetos mediante la interfaz de línea de comandos (CLI).

Cuando utilice la interfaz de línea de comandos, especifique el tamaño de parte que elija y Oracle Cloud Infrastructure Object Storage divide el objeto en partes y realiza la carga de todas las partes de forma automática. Puede definir el número máximo de piezas que se pueden cargar en paralelo. De forma predeterminada, la CLI limita el número de piezas que se pueden cargar en paralelo a tres. Cuando use la CLI, no tiene que realizar una confirmación cuando se haya completado la carga.

Abra un símbolo del sistema e introduzca un comando similar al siguiente:

oci os object put -ns <object_storage_namespace> -bn <bucket_name> --file <file_path> --name <object_name> --part-size <upload_part_size_in_MiB> --parallel-upload-count <maximum_number_parallel_uploads>

Defina los siguientes valores de parámetro e indicador:

  • <object_storage_namespace>: Espacio de nombres de nivel superior utilizado para la solicitud. Si no se proporciona, este parámetro se obtendrá internamente mediante una llamada a oci os ns get.
  • <bucket_name>: nombre del bloque de almacenamiento.
  • <file_path>: Ruta de acceso completa del archivo, incluido el nombre del mismo.
  • <object_name>: Nombre del objeto. El valor por defecto es el nombre de archivo, excepto la ruta de acceso.
  • <upload_part_size_in_MiB>: tamaño de cada varias partes en mibibytes (MiB).
  • <maximum_number_parallel_uploads>: número máximo de piezas que se pueden cargar en paralelo. El valor por defecto es 3.